About the Role
As a SEO Analyst, you'll support R/GA's SEO team by providing multichannel (SEO, brand, PR, social) analysis and insight to address global search trends towards AI search usage. We help global brands adapt to changing online consumer behaviours, and with the rise of AI search, we're looking for someone who understands not just on-page SEO fundamentals, but also off-page factors like brand, PR, and social media marketing.
This is a highly collaborative role that requires you to work closely with our PR, Community, and Social Media teams, as well as developers, business analysts, and product owners. You will be the bridge between traditional SEO and cutting-edge AI strategy.
Your ability to build a strong working relationship with the product owner will be critical in creating user stories and ensuring SEO work is effectively prioritised within our development sprints. You'll use AI search monitoring tools to derive data-driven insights and guide content efforts across the business.
Key Responsibilities
- AI Search Strategy & Monitoring: Utilise an AI search monitoring tool to track and analyse how our brand and products are represented in AI-generated search results. Identify opportunities and risks, and develop strategic plans to influence a positive and accurate narrative.
- Agile SEO Integration: Work within an agile framework, participating in sprint planning and other ceremonies to integrate SEO requirements into the development workflow. Create and manage user stories to define SEO tasks and work with cross-functional teams to get them prioritised.
- Multichannel Content Strategy: Develop and execute a comprehensive content strategy that aligns with our SEO objectives and informs the work of our PR, Community, and Social Media teams towards influencing AI search answers.
- Cross-Functional Collaboration: Partner with the PR team to ensure our press releases and media mentions are optimised for AI retrieval. Work with the Community team to encourage positive, brand-aligned user-generated content, and collaborate with the Social Media team to craft content that is highly citable by LLMs.
- Content Creation & Optimisation: Guide the creation of content that is not only valuable to human audiences but also structured and optimised for AI ingestion. This includes influencing brand messaging, tone of voice, and the use of FAQs and structured data.
Data Analysis & Reporting: Regularly report on the performance of our AI search strategies, using data from our monitoring tools, Google Analytics, and other platforms. Provide clear, actionable insights and recommendations to stakeholders.Thought Leadership: Stay abreast of the latest developments in generative AI, LLMs, and search engine algorithms. Act as an internal subject matter expert, educating the wider business on the implications of AI search
